Mrs. Edna Maples, 81, of 5058 Main Drive, New Hope, died Tuesday at a Huntsville nursing home.
A graveside service will be Thursday at 2 p.m. at the Moon Cemetery with the Rev. Rickey Honea officiating and New Hope Funeral Home in charge.
Survivors include a daughter, Retha Maples Durgos of Las Vegas; a brother, W. D. Cobb of Florida; four sisters, Kathleen Bounds and Estelle Gibbs, both of Mississippi, Henrietta Baker of Huntsville and Ethel Fitzhugh of California; and four grandchildren.
Mrs. Maples was the wife of Lawrence Dewey Maples who preceded her in death on May 1, 1971.
